The Admin War + Beanstalk Part 2 Update, is a continuation and expansion of the Beanstalk event in Roblox: Grow a Garden.
This update introduced numerous new mutations, pets, plants, and mechanics, following an Admin War event hosted by developer Jandel.
Grow a Garden Beanstalk Event Part 2: Overview
The core Beanstalk event mechanics remain similar, requiring players to feed specific plant types to an NPC named Jack to grow the beanstalk. The goal is to reach 900 points to make the beanstalk grow.
The rarity of the plants you contribute determines the points you receive:

The parkour to climb the beanstalk has also become more challenging.
As you climb the beanstalk, you’ll find five glowing orbs with special rewards, such as Reclaimers, Sprout Seed Packs, Sprinklers, and Mutation Spray Bloom.
Being at the top of the leaderboard when the beanstalk grows grants additional rewards.
After contributing to the beanstalk’s growth seven times, a portal unlocks at the base, allowing instant teleportation to the top.
Goliath’s Goods and the New Friendship Shop
At the top of the beanstalk, you’ll find Goliath’s Goods shop. This shop has been expanded with a new “Friendship” tab.

To unlock the Friendship tab and its items, you must feed Goliath cooked food. The rarity of the cooked food dictates the friendship points gained.
Increasing your friendship level with Goliath unlocks more items in the Friendship Shop. For example, Level 1 requires 20 points, Level 2 requires 30 points, and up to Level 6 requires 70 points.

A new Crafting Bench is located at the top of the Beanstalk, allowing you to craft exclusive items using event-specific plants and fruits.

Pet Achievements
New “Core Pets” achievements were added, mirroring the existing plant achievements.
Completing these can earn rewards like Mega Lollipops, Egg Incubators, and Pet Shard Rainbows. Divine pet achievements specifically reward a Mutation Machine Booster.
Level Reward Track UI
The ‘Player’ section now shows your garden level and the fence skins you unlock at each level, such as the Picket Fence at Level 10, Silver Fence at Level 20, Metal Fence at Level 30, Jail Fence at Level 40, and Golden Fence at Level 50.
Other Key Changes & New Items
The Cleansing Pet Shard was added, allowing you to remove a mutation from a pet.
Sprinklers were moved from crafting to a randomly spawning Sprinkler Merchant.
Egg Shop: Uncommon, Rare, and Legendary eggs were reintroduced, and Summer eggs were moved to a Summer merchant.
New Items:
- Mega Level up Lollipop: Instantly sets a pet to Level 100.
- Gold Level up Lollipop: Gives 10 levels to a pet.
- Silver Level up Lollipop: Gives 5 levels to a pet.
- Egg Incubator: Speeds up egg hatching when powered by fruit.
- Mutation Machine Booster: Speeds up the pet mutation machine when placed in your garden.
- New fence skins.
